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$13.97 | 4.173% | $14.553 | $14.55 | $14.55 | $14.60 |
Purchase #2 | $73.86 | 6.461% | $78.6321 | $78.63 | $78.65 | $78.60 |
Purchase #3 | $153.41 | 10.470% | $169.472 | $169.47 | $169.45 | $169.50 |
Purchase #4 | $41.88 | 6.724% | $44.696 | $44.70 | $44.70 | $44.70 |
Purchase #5 | $247.83 | 5.315% | $261.0022 | $261.00 | $261.00 | $261.00 |
Purchase #6 | $47.27 | 5.737% | $49.9819 | $49.98 | $50.00 | $50.00 |
Purchase #7 | $239.63 | 7.381% | $257.3171 | $257.32 | $257.30 | $257.30 |
7 purchase totals = | $817.85 | $875.6543 | $875.65 | $875.65 | $875.70 |
